Is there a train from the airport to Kandy?
4 Answers from travellers
No. The airport is not on the train line. You have to take a bus or tuk-tuk to the nearest station (Seeduwa or Gampaha), then catch the train. With luggage, it is a huge hassle.
The train is only useful if you are already in the city center. Don't try to train-hop from the airport.
Taking the train with heavy bags is a nightmare. Spend the $40 on a private driver, you won't regret it.
Scam Watch: kandy
TukTuk or tour drivers take you to "gem museums" or "government-certified" gem shops. They receive huge commissions (up to 40%) on anything you buy. Prices are inflated 3-10x the actual value.
Men approach tourists near Temple of the Tooth offering to be guides. After the tour, they demand large "donations" or guide fees (5000-10000 LKR).
